Understanding Responsible Gambling
Responsible gambling refers to the practice of gambling in a way that does not negatively impact one’s life or the lives of others. This concept encompasses an awareness of one’s gambling behavior and its potential consequences. By acknowledging the risks associated with gambling, individuals can better control their habits and avoid developing unhealthy patterns. One of the core principles of responsible gambling is setting limits. This means deciding in advance how much time and money one is willing to spend and sticking to those predetermined limits. When individuals create a personal budget for gambling, they can enjoy the entertainment aspect without compromising their financial stability. This strategy not only promotes fun but also reduces the risk of compulsive gambling behaviors.
Another important aspect is recognizing the signs of problem gambling. These can include feelings of guilt after gambling, borrowing money to fund gambling activities, or neglecting personal and professional responsibilities. Being self-aware and vigilant can help individuals take action before a gambling problem escalates. Therefore, understanding responsible gambling is essential for fostering a safe and enjoyable gaming environment.
Setting Personal Limits
Setting personal limits is one of the most effective strategies for maintaining responsible gambling habits. Individuals should define clear boundaries around the amount of money they are willing to gamble and the time they are willing to spend on these activities. These limits can act as a safety net, ensuring that gambling remains a form of entertainment rather than a financial burden. Keeping track of expenditures and time spent can help individuals stay accountable to themselves.
Additionally, these limits can be adjusted based on individual circumstances. For instance, someone may decide to set a more stringent limit during challenging financial times or may choose to expand their limits when their financial situation improves. This flexibility allows individuals to engage in gambling responsibly while also adapting to their changing personal circumstances. It’s a proactive approach that emphasizes control over one’s gambling behaviors.
Moreover, using tools like self-exclusion programs can help reinforce personal limits. Many gambling venues and online platforms offer the option to limit access or set deposit limits. Utilizing such tools can provide an extra layer of security, making it easier to stay within the set boundaries. By setting personal limits, individuals can significantly reduce the risk of problematic gambling while ensuring they enjoy the entertainment value of games.
Recognizing Emotional Triggers
Understanding emotional triggers is vital for responsible gambling. Individuals often gamble as a way to escape stress, anxiety, or other negative emotions. By recognizing these triggers, one can avoid gambling during times of emotional vulnerability. Keeping a journal can be a helpful tool for tracking moods and gambling behaviors, providing insights into when one is more likely to gamble impulsively.
For instance, if a person notices they tend to gamble more after a stressful day at work, they can find healthier ways to cope with that stress. Engaging in activities such as exercise, meditation, or spending time with loved ones can offer emotional relief without the risks associated with gambling. Understanding emotional triggers not only promotes responsible gambling but also encourages a healthier lifestyle overall.
Furthermore, seeking support from friends and family can be beneficial. Sharing feelings and experiences with loved ones can help individuals stay grounded and avoid slipping into harmful gambling patterns. Additionally, support groups and counseling services can provide guidance and strategies to manage emotions effectively. Recognizing emotional triggers is a proactive strategy that can lead to a healthier approach to gambling.
Educating Yourself on Gambling Odds
Another key strategy for maintaining responsible gambling habits is educating oneself about gambling odds and probabilities. Many people engage in gambling without fully understanding how odds work, leading to misconceptions about the likelihood of winning. This lack of knowledge can result in unrealistic expectations and increased gambling activity, which can contribute to harmful habits.
By taking the time to learn about the odds associated with different games, individuals can make informed decisions about their gambling activities. For example, understanding the odds of winning in a game like blackjack compared to slot machines can significantly influence where one chooses to place their bets. This knowledge empowers players to make more strategic choices, thereby promoting a more responsible gambling experience.
Furthermore, many casinos and gaming platforms provide educational resources about their games and odds. Taking advantage of these resources can enhance one’s understanding and provide a clearer picture of what to expect. This education not only enriches the gaming experience but also reinforces the importance of responsible gambling by aligning expectations with reality.
